Embodiment 1
[0052] This example is used to illustrate the extraction method of camellia oleifera cake protein provided by the present invention.
[0053] (1) Camellia cake with a particle size of 100-120 mesh (purchased from the Institute of Subtropical Forestry, Chinese Academy of Forestry, with an oil content of 8% by weight, without removing tea saponin, according to the literature (Wu Xiaochun, Journal of Yichun University, 2008 The protein content was determined to be 16% by weight according to the method in the fourth issue of 2008, 29-30).) 100 grams were mixed with 33 grams of absolute ethanol and 2700 grams of distilled water and sodium hydroxide was added to adjust the pH to 9.8 to obtain the first mixture. And the first mixture was stirred at room temperature for 20 minutes. Embodiment 2
[0062] This example is used to illustrate the method of the present invention. In this example, the protein of camellia cake meal is extracted according to the following steps:
[0063] (1) Camellia cake with a particle size of 100-120 mesh (purchased from the Institute of Subtropical Forestry, Chinese Academy of Forestry, with an oil content of 8% by weight, according to the literature (Wu Xiaochun, Journal of Yichun University, 2008, Issue 4, 29- 30 pages) method to determine its protein content is 16% by weight) 100 grams, 20 grams of absolute ethanol and 2500 grams of distilled water are mixed and sodium hydroxide is added to adjust the pH to 9.5 to obtain the first mixture, and the first mixture is kept at room temperature Stir for 15 minutes.
